Avon Lake Boat Club Serves Up Valentine's Perch to Beach Park Towers' Residents
More than 100 take part in annual tradition.
More than 100 Beach Park Towers’ residents enjoyed an all-you-can-eat Valentine’s perch dinner Feb. 11. Master cooks each year are Dave Kalo and George Puskas.

Boat club secretary Joe Slife said the event’s success was dependant on numerous people.
“As usual, special thanks to Gerry and Frank Savel who always coordinate the preparation and service,” Slife said. “We also have annual participation by the (Middle School) Builder's Club to help with the service and cleanup.”
